About 1 Inglenook House
1 Inglenook House is a one-bedroom semi-detached house in Hawkhurst, Cranbrook, Cranbrook (TN18 4AT). It has a recorded floor area of 36 m² (around 388 sq ft) and construction records dating it to 1900-1929. The latest certificate (December 2020) shows a D (score 67),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. Earlier certificates rated it C (February 2010); the latest reading is one band lower. Between certificates, window efficiency went from Very Poor to Good and lighting went from Average to Good. The recommended improvements would push it to C (score 77).
At 36 m² it sits well below the postcode median (95 m² across 8 EPCs), making it one of the more compact homes locally. Across 2002–2022, sale prices on this property compounded at 2.8%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£147,000 is 13.1% above the 2022 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£335/sq ft) was about 90.5%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Last sale on file: £130,000 in January 2022. That sale was during the post-pandemic price surge, when transactions cleared materially above pre-2020 trend.
